As … lee fisher associates ltdWebPhenotype: Base coat colors are lightened (diluted) to paler shades. For example, black becomes a gray-blue color (often called "blue" by breeders) and chocolate brown becomes a pale silvery red (often called "lilac" or "isabella"). Mode of Inheritance: Autosomal recessive.
